Output e36faddeaf577b9210834fac42c34bab6a0a98779b7168f54608bcc5e8ef7f69:40

value
962904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c84d567d105c05cb128ad31f80ccf2ec9886ad OP_EQUAL
address
3NdzchxCTCVsTkSeFktSGBinYts2YaVBAe
transaction
e36faddeaf577b9210834fac42c34bab6a0a98779b7168f54608bcc5e8ef7f69
spent
true